Lobster Bay #9

Summer Sanctuary

Rate this book
Her husband framed her. Her career is over. Her life is in ruins.

When her prestigious art career implodes Julia flees to Tides Inn hoping to disappear. But innkeeper Jane Miller has a sixth sense about troubled guests, and this coastal community has its own way of turning things right.

Soon Julia finds herself being adopted by the other guests at the inn, a retired magician, genealogy-obsessed twins, and a bird-watching librarian who see right through her lies—and don't care.

Julia fools herself into thinking she can fit in and make genuine friends, building a quiet new life where no one knows her past—until her secret is exposed and everything changes.

But when she gets ready to flee again, Jane, Maxi, Claire and Andie will haven none of it. Instead, they roll up their sleeves ready to take on corporate lawyers, powerful ex-husbands, and anyone else who thinks they can destroy one of their own, because in this town, lost souls find families willing to fight for what's right.

Summer Sanctuary is the 9th book in the Lobster Bay series.
Julia Ashford pulls into the Tides Inn while running from the public disgrace of her former life as an art expert, after her ex-husband dragged her reputation through the mud over a mistake he himself had made.
Unknown to Julia, the observant people who own the inn, along with their friends, will quickly become very important in rebuilding not only her credibility, but also give her a new purpose in life.

These are women's fiction books that all have a purpose of redeeming something that was wrongfully done to someone.
There are developed characters, and a solid plotline.

Summer Sanctuary is the 9th book in the Lobster Bay series by Meredith Summers.
All books can be read as stand alone books.

I really enjoy this women's fiction series.

The protagonist is Julia Ashford who arrives at the Tides Inn after dealing with a failed public career and a messy divorce.

The women at the Inn have a sense about Julia and that they need her help.

I really enjoy how well the characters are written. The characters are well developed, fleshed out and flawed.

I love the setting of the Inn and Julia's journey.
